Abstract

Penelitian ini bertujuan untuk mengimplementasikan media pembelajaran berbasis game interaktif Wordwall guna meningkatkan partisipasi dan keaktifan siswa kelas VI dalam proses pembelajaran. Game interaktif ini dirancang untuk memberikan pengalaman belajar yang menyenangkan dan meningkatkan keterlibatan siswa dengan menggunakan berbagai macam kuis dan tantangan yang dapat diakses secara digital. Metode penelitian yang digunakan adalah penelitian tindakan kelas (PTK) dengan siklus yang melibatkan perencanaan, pelaksanaan, observasi, dan refleksi. Hasil penelitian menunjukkan adanya peningkatan yang signifikan dalam partisipasi dan keaktifan siswa selama proses pembelajaran. Siswa lebih termotivasi untuk berpartisipasi aktif dalam diskusi dan aktivitas kelompok, serta menunjukkan peningkatan dalam pemahaman materi. Media Wordwall terbukti efektif dalam menciptakan suasana belajar yang lebih menarik dan interaktif. Diharapkan, penggunaan media berbasis game ini dapat dijadikan alternatif dalam mengatasi tantangan pembelajaran di kelas.

Abstract

This study aims to determine the learning outcomes of students in Magnet material using digital-based snake and ladder media in grade V of SD Negeri 101766 Bandar Setia. The method used is Classroom Action Research (PTK) which consists of 4 stages of activities in each cycle consisting of action planning, implementation of actions, observation/data collection and finally reflection. The subjects in this study are 24 students in class V of SD Negeri 101766 Bandar Setia. The instruments used in this study are multiple-choice test questions as many as 10 questions and an assessment rubric. The data collection technique uses direct observation techniques and uses quantitative data analysis techniques. The results of the research from the implementation of two cycles, where in the pre-cycle stage obtained student learning outcomes with an average of 65.83, then carried out the first cycle obtained a learning outcome score with an average of 75.42 which increased from pre-cycle to cycle I of 9.59. Finally, conducting cycle II obtained a learning outcome score of 82.08 which increased from cycle I to cycle II of 6.66. It can be concluded that the use of digital-based snake and ladder media can improve students' social science learning outcomes

Abstract

This article is the result of the community service activity of a team of lecturers and students of Universitas Muslim Nusantara Al-Washliyah from the English literature study program. The purpose of this community service is to share knowledge of the use of linguistic landscape as a medium for English language. Landscape linguistics is a study of language use in public spaces. The program was designed to enhance students’ exposure to English through the strategic use of signs, posters, labels, and educational displays placed in the school environment. The implementation of this program demonstrated that the linguistic landscape could function as an effective, low-cost, and sustainable learning medium. Students showed increased interest and familiarity with English vocabulary and expressions encountered in their daily school activities. Furthermore, the program proved that English language learning can be harmoniously integrated into a religious-based educational setting without disrupting the school’s focus on Qur'an memorization. Through this activity, it is hoped that it will increase the knowledge and insight of the participant.

Abstract

Studies related to revisit intention are important, especially in the post-COVID-19 pandemic era. At that time, many tourism destinations and businesses were destroyed and tended to close, so a strategy was needed to revive revisit intention at tourist destinations in Indonesia. This study aims to provide a tourism marketing perspective on tour service quality, Cleanliness, Health, Safety, and environmental sustainability (CHSE), tourist satisfaction, and gender. Tourist satisfaction as a mediator and gender as a moderator. This study employs a quantitative approach, data collection with a questionnaire, with a sample of domestic tourists. The study was conducted from June to September 2024, using a questionnaire administered directly via Google Forms. The study included 350 respondents; the sample was determined using purposive sampling. Data have been analyzed using Structural Equation Modeling and Multi-Group Analysis with Smart PLS 3.0. This investigation found that both female and male tourists: tour service quality has a positive effect on tourist satisfaction and revisit intention. Meanwhile, for both females and males, the role of CHSE does not significantly affect revisit intention. Tourist satisfaction has a positive effect on revisit intention. The results of the indirect effect show that tourist satisfaction mediates the effects of tour service quality and CHSE on revisit intention, for both males and females. The moderation effect of gender in the relationship between tour service quality, CHSE, and tour satisfaction has a positive influence, but the relationship is not significant.

Abstract

This study examined how ideological tensions between traditional family stability and individual aspiration were discursively constructed in In Your Dreams (2025) through sibling dialogue and dream sequences. Grounded in Ruth Wodak’s Discourse-Historical Approach (DHA) within Critical Discourse Analysis (CDA), the study focused on five core strategies: nomination, predication, argumentation, perspectivization, and intensification/mitigation. Using qualitative textual analysis of selected script excerpts, the research systematically reconstructed argumentative structures through the claim, warrant, conclusion model to identify the operation of the topos of threat and the topos of loss at the micro-linguistic level (lexical choice, modality, metaphor, and pronoun use). The findings demonstrated that family conflict was discursively framed not merely as interpersonal disagreement but as a structured moral negotiation. Nostalgic generalization and mitigation normalized conflict while simultaneously revealing epistemic insecurity, whereas modal intensification and symbolic metaphor in dream sequences amplified perceptions of instability. Through predication, parental figures were constructed as embodying competing moral orientations, sustainability versus passion, without explicit delegitimation, resulting in ideological ambiguity. The dreamscape served as an arena in which these tensions were dramatized and ultimately rearticulated into a hybrid moral resolution. This study contributes to CDA-based film analysis by demonstrating how DHA’s argumentative reconstruction can systematically expose ideological positioning in animated family narratives through explicit micro-linguistic evidence. Future research should integrate multimodal analysis and audience reception to extend the interpretive scope.

Abstract

Sumber Daya Manusia berperan penting dalam memobilitas suatu organisasi atau perusahaan. Metode yang digunakan dalam penelitian ini adalah metode deskriptif dengan pendekatan kuantitatif pada SDM yang telah memanfaatkan Green Human Resource Management (GHRM). Teknik analisis data yang digunakan adalah Statistical Package for The Social Sciences (SPSS) Versi 25, dengan metode pengambilan sampel menggunakan sampel jenuh. Hasil penelitian ini menunjukkan bahwa secara simultan Green Human Resource Management berkontribusi besar terhadap keberlanjutan kinerja sumber daya manusia yang terlihat dari nilai R2 sebersar 61,1%. Hal ini membuktikan bahwa teori pendekatan holistik dalam Green Human Resource Management lebih efektif daripada pendekatan secara parsial

Abstract

This study aims to describe the ecranisation process of intrinsic elements, including plot, characters, and settings, from the novel "Cinta dalam Ikhlas" (2017) by Kang Abay into its film adaptation (2024) directed by Fajar Bustomi. The method employed is descriptive qualitative with content analysis techniques. The ecranisation theory used covers three main processes: reduction (shrinkage), expansion (addition), and variation change. The results show that in the plot aspect, there is a reduction in the main character's middle school memories and a variation change in the exam announcement medium from newspapers to online systems. In the character aspect, there is a reduction in the number of the main character's siblings and the removal of several supporting characters. Meanwhile, in the setting aspect, visual adjustments were made to support the dramatization of the story on the big screen. In conclusion, the transformation from novel to film underwent various significant changes to adapt to the duration and aesthetics of audio-visual media without losing the essence of the religious message in the story.

Abstract

Tujuan utama penelitian ini adalah untuk mengetahui kondisi sumberdaya dan kemampuan dalam bisnis di Ekowisata Batu Katak dengan menggunakan analisis Valueable, Rare, unImitability, Organize (VRIO). Penulisan paper ini menggunakan metode Kualitatif. Penelitian ini termasukpenelitian deskriptif. Berdasarkan keterlibatan peneliti adalah tidak mengintervensi data. Berdasarkan unit analisis sampel  yang digunakan adalah pihak yang mempelopori dibukanya ekowisata Batu Katak. Narasumber yang digunakan adalah narasumber yang berkompeten serta mengetahui kondisi Ekowisata Batu Katak dan mengerti konsep pariwisata. Temuan bahwa Kompetensi inti yang dimiliki oleh ekowisata batu katak  yang berasal dari sumberdaya tangible adalah   kondisi Alam, bunga bangkai yang unik (Amorphophallus titanum) yang tersebar di kebun masyarakat, bahan baku penyedia makanan yang diambil langsung dari kebun masyarakat,  atraksi wisata seperti trekking, tubing, susur gua juga merupakan kekuatan dalam pengembangan ekowisata. Adapun kompetensi lain yang berasail dari sumberdaya intangible dan berdaya saing dengan pesaingnya adalah kedekatan dengan pengunjung dan Berbatasan langsung dengan Taman Nasional Gunung Leuser, oleh UNESCO sebagai Tropical Rainforest Heritage of Sumatera. Kompetensi di bidang kapabilitas yang dianggap kurang dan memerlukan perhatian khusus adalah skill pemasaran.

Abstract

This study investigated the linguistic landscape of shop signs in Medan and Kuala Lumpur. The objectives focus on three points, namely, the language choice, multilingual writing, and visual aspects of shop signs. The study employed mixed-method design with data of shop signs pictures in Medan and Kuala Lumpur. Data collected using photographic documentation of shop signs. The shop signs were analysed by combining linguistic landscape analysis with language choice, multilingual writing and visual semiotic analysis. The findings identified three points. First, different language choices in Medan and Kuala Lumpur. Most language choices in Medan are monolingual and in Kuala Lumpur are bilingual and multilingual. Second, complementary multilingual writing is predominantly found in Medan while dominantly found in Kuala Lumpur. Third, most the text position as main information on shop signs in Medan are in the middle of the signs or under the signboard while in Kuala Lumpur, the text position as main information on shop signs is in the top right on signboard. The use of fonts and colours of both countries are still the same. The conclusion of the study is that linguistic diversity reflects the multicultural populations in both cities and the importance of using languages to appeal to a wide customer base.

Abstract

The rapid advancement of Artificial Intelligence (AI) has opened new pathways for English for Specific Purposes (ESP) pedagogy, particularly in the acquisition of technical vocabulary. This study aims to investigate the integration of ChatGPT in enhancing students’ morphological awareness of tourism-related technical terms. Employing a quasi-experimental design, the study involved two groups of tourism students: an experimental group that used ChatGPT-assisted learning and a control group that followed conventional dictionary-based methods. Data were collected through pre-tests and post-tests focusing on morphological decomposition and word formation tasks, complemented by semi-structured interviews. The findings reveal that the experimental group significantly outperformed the control group in identifying derivational affixes and understanding compound words specific to the tourism industry. ChatGPT provided personalized, real-time linguistic explanations, thereby facilitating deeper cognitive processing of complex terminology. The study concludes that AI integration not only enhances morphological competence but also promotes learner autonomy. These results suggest that ESP practitioners should strategically incorporate AI tools to bridge the gap between theoretical linguistics and professional communication in the field of tourism.
